ICC Postpones Doha Governance Meeting Over Middle East Conflict

An ICC notice to members said the Doha session will move to next month somewhere on the same continent.

Overview

  • The three-day gathering scheduled for March 25–27 in Qatar has been delayed, PTI reported, citing an ICC source.
  • The meeting is expected to reconvene next month in the same region, with exact dates and venue yet to be confirmed.
  • Members received the postponement notice on Saturday, a day before the T20 World Cup final in Ahmedabad.
  • The Doha venue had been selected after the ICC highlighted growing collaboration with the Qatar Cricket Association and the Qatar Olympic Committee.
  • Board directors, chief executives, committee members and senior leadership had been slated to review key governance matters at the session.
